Description

MgLa2S4 crystallizes in the orthorhombic Pnma space group. The structure is three-dimensional. Mg2+ is bonded in a trigonal pyramidal geometry to four S2- atoms. There are a spread of Mg–S bond distances ranging from 2.33–2.42 Å. There are two inequivalent La3+ sites. In the first La3+ site, La3+ is bonded in a 7-coordinate geometry to seven S2- atoms. There are a spread of La–S bond distances ranging from 2.87–3.27 Å. In the second La3+ site, La3+ is bonded in a 6-coordinate geometry to six S2- atoms. There are a spread of La–S bond distances ranging from 2.73–3.06 Å. There are three inequivalent S2- sites. In the first S2- site, S2- is bonded in a 5-coordinate geometry to one Mg2+ and four La3+ atoms. In the second S2- site, S2- is bonded in a T-shaped geometry to one Mg2+ and two La3+ atoms. In the third S2- site, S2- is bonded in a distorted rectangular see-saw-like geometry to one Mg2+ and three La3+ atoms.
